Applications System Administrator I

JOB SUMMARY:

Ā 

Has responsibility to meet or exceed the required expectations of our ā€œESPā€ (Exceptional Service Provider) program (refer to the Employee Handbook).Ā 

Ā 

In accordance with established policies and procedures, and direction from the VP Project Management, Data Processing. This individual manages assigned product lines from implementation through deployment and life cycle.Ā  The individual will coordinate updates, enhancements, and expansion of essential banking software systems and assures the delivery of information in a timely manner to customers both internal and external.Ā  This individual helps support the Bank’s Data Processing daily functions and assists end users with system understanding and functionality.Ā  The individual also provides department and bank compliance reporting on a monthly, quarterly, and annual basis. The work of the successful candidate influences the professional image of the Bank within the community it serves.

Ā 

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S & ABILITIES REQUIRED:

Ā 

  • Ability to prepare and interpret detailed verbal or written instructions and/or perform complex mathematical functions.
  • Prior knowledge of bank core system, ancillary, and office desktop applications is highly preferred.
  • A minimum of 5 years of prior experience in the following areas or combination of areas is required: compliance, item processing, electronic banking, bank core system, product management, ancillary, or other system administration.
  • Demonstrated ability to learn, implement and maintain new systems.
  • Minimum educational requirements include a high school diploma, college degree is preferred.
  • Strong communication, analytical, and problem-solving skills.
  • The candidate should demonstrate proficiency in organization and prioritization of the workflows.Ā 
  • The capability to work well under pressure and meet daily deadlines is essential to successful job performance.
  • Demonstrated ability to utilize tact, confidentiality and good customer service skills when dealing with other bank personnel, clients, and vendors.
  • Advanced proficiency in all aspects of personal computers (Microsoft Office products, Internet browsers, etc.) is necessary.
  • Ability to learn new software, applications, create standard operating procedures, and complete training for a variety of end users.

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ES / EXPECTATIONS (Weighting cannot exceed 100%; Each % represents the value of the job, not time spent):

Ā 

  • Job Performance Behaviors: Contributing to organization success, job effectiveness, relationships, and customer satisfaction.Ā  (Weighting Percentage: 20%)

Ā 

  • Provide ongoing technical and administrative support for various systems within the bank. (Weighting Percentage: 20%)

Ā 

  • Provide support in the installation, update, and maintenance of banking application software (Weighting Percentage: 20%)

Ā 

  • Maintain various procedure manuals and user guides to ensure repetitive procedures are accurately completed in case of absenteeism, pandemic, or DRP. (Weighting Percentage: 10%)

Ā 

  • Provide reviews and maintenance of current equipment, software, and processes to ensure that all banking operation activities are conducted in an efficient and effective manner. (Weighting Percentage: 20%)

Ā 

  • Coordinate activities with third party vendors on various systems as assigned. Work through problems reported and request system enhancements for deficiencies and work on planned future developments and implementations. (Weighting Percentage: 10%)

Ā 

Ā 

SECONDARY RESPONSIBILITIES:

Ā 

  • Other duties as assigned or deemed necessary by VP Project Management, Data Processing manager and/or Chief Strategy & Innovation Officerto ensure a continuous workflow of daily operations.
  • Conduct training of users on banking application software
  • Performs vendor defined user maintenance and preventative maintenance on core application software.
  • Maintains log (using automated tracking system) of core application related issues/ problems.
  • Assist with testing and deployment of new technologies.
